- When a bored Holmes eagerly takes the case of Gabrielle Valladon after an attempt on her life, the search for her missing husband leads to Loch Ness and the legendary monster.
- Ernest Walter addresses how he came to be an editor in WWII, how he was hired for this film, the original script, 2 stories being cut from the film, what little he knew of Peter O'Toole and Peter Sellers being considered for cast, Wilder's personality on set, how he met producer Walter Mirisch, the prologue and boathouse and homosexual innuendo scenes that were cut, his interview with Franklin J. Schaffner for Nicholas and Alexandra, the tongue in cheek personal nature of the film, his medical accident (stroke) during the filming of Superman, and his retirement to teaching at the National Film School.
